Output c51e41115bf617ff413b1a56739fa4e73f255b6ccd328dfbfb659047abf4a5f3:3

value
663640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ac3794982e7f8c90cdd60332620509ac4c5f23a4 OP_EQUAL
address
3HPcjLRj53K6zE46qBgZhmdrFxaxJD22kq
transaction
c51e41115bf617ff413b1a56739fa4e73f255b6ccd328dfbfb659047abf4a5f3
spent
true